description Measurements of total iodine (I) and iodine-129 (129I) concentrations in rivers and lakes of Argentina are presented. Their latitudinal distribution can be explained by taking into account their main sources (oceanic emissions and biomass burning for I, and atmospheric nuclear tests for 129I), transport mechanisms, and fallout patterns. From the measured 129I concentrations in the studied lakes, deposition fluences for their catchment areas were estimated. These results agree with a model of the global deposition pattern due to the 129I released by atmospheric nuclear weapon tests and with other fluences reported for the southern hemisphere.
